26 Whoever serves me must follow me; and where I am, my servant also will be.(A) My Father will honor the one who serves me.
27 “Now my soul is troubled,(B) and what shall I say? ‘Father,(C) save me from this hour’?(D) No, it was for this very reason I came to this hour. 28 Father, glorify your name!”
Then a voice came from heaven,(E) “I have glorified it, and will glorify it again.”
